Pros

Golf and gym benefits for employees

Cons

They actually don’t want employees using said benefits… at every corner they will find a way to reduce your opportunities to use such benefits, ie: reducing gym hours for employees to the most inconvenient times, and make you go through a completely beaucratic process just to get a tee time… and then the golf pro will not respond to said 2x times forwarded email. The GM keeps a club of 6 executives that are either inept or unwilling to help the rest of staff. The marketing executive’s job could be done by a free college intern - and they know it so they gatekeep all printing of menus, signage, and promotional material. The GM will show up in a tee shirt and flip flops and then criticize employees for wearing the wrong color socks. It is supposed to be a prestigious club but hold no members accountable for their behavior at all. They let members verbally abuse employees with zero repercussions. Upper management will squeeze all the life out of all its employees and then just move onto a new batch. AND THEY HARDLY PROMOTE FROM WITHIN

Pros

There are many perks that come with working at Snowmass Club. Gym usage, golf privledges, 401k benefits, and generous PTO/sick time.

Cons

It seems that the GM gets paid to play pickleball all day. It is disheartening to see a leader delegate all of his responsibilities to harder working managers, live on property rent free, and take 6 months of vacation a year. Zero visibility and complete disregard for what happens on property. There is also little room for growth and advancement. This is not the fault of the club, as there is not much turnover within senior leadership.
